Strategy
The Dohmen Global Conservative folio invests in U.S. and international large- and mid-cap equity ETFs, dividend producing equity ETFs, and fixed income ETFs when appropriate according to Dohmen’s analysis. The analysis focuses on credit markets which show stress or lack of stress, thus giving signals as to potential, important trend changes. This is combined with advanced technical analysis of the markets and sectors, using money flow analysis and other technical indicators.
Dohmen does not take the “buy and hold forever” approach. Dohmen believes that market timing is essential to avoid big losses. The strategy is to use market timing of the major market indices, with emphasis on advanced technical analysis. This folio is aimed to be more conservative and does not hedge by investing in inverse ETFs. During times of adversity and potential equity market vulnerability, Dohmen may hedge by investing in U.S. and international high-grade fixed income ETFs, as well as increasing the cash allocation. The percentage allocation between equity and fixed income will vary from 100% equity with 0% fixed income, to 0% equity with 100% fixed income depending on Dohmen’s analysis and technical indicators. The latter allocation would be during a potential market plunge or crisis.
To further reduce risk in the equity portion, Dohmen aims to use global equal-weighted equity ETFs when available. These give an equal weight to each stock in the index. Dohmen considers this weighting more conservative than the typical capitalization-weighted indices, where a strong drop in just 1 large-cap stock can cause a sharp decline in the ETF. By giving an equal weight to each stock, such volatility can be smoothed out.
